I love chai and great chai is hard to come by, let alone find. On a walking excursion, I came across a tiny cafe, almost so small I had to back track to be sure. Needing a pick me up, I saw chai on the menu and ordered one with the addition of 3 shots of espresso and oat milk - totaling $9.90. Luckily I had cash, with a card or Apple Pay less than $10 my total would have included a $0.69 transaction fee. I must admit, the amount paid was well worth it. My chai was exceptionally hot but not too hot, allowing me to partake immediately. The roast of the espresso was well balanced lacking any bitterness, complimenting the slightly spiced chai. The ratio of chai to water, sweetness level, presence of emphasized spice notes and a beautiful roast of espresso beans presented the most flavorful chai. There menu is quite expansive and prices reasonably priced. I will revisit when I am in the neighborhood again.
